Photo taken along the North Shore of the Salton Sea. It was exceptionally windy that day, and the waves crashed up on the shore as if it were an ocean! Randy was more familiar with the Salton Sea than many of the rest of us, and he was pretty amazed at how strongly the wind was blowing the waves on this particular afternoon. He considered such wind to be pretty rare. Therefore, I feel very fortunate that I got some of the dramatic photos that I did! |
Just as the sun set, we all walked over to the North Shore (not too far from our camping site) and admired the Salton Sea. We were in an area that gets a lot of fishermen during the weekend. The Salton Sea is apparently an excellent place to fish. But when this photo was taken, no fishermen were around. It was a lovely, solitary experience. |
